Diurnal variations in phytoplankton pigments in the Vellar Estuary
Diurnal variations in phytoplankton pigments in the water on 3/ 4 September, 1969, at 3 stations in the Vellar estuary were investigated. The peak values of pigment content of the water were:
Chlorophyll a .. 19.CO µg/l
Chlorophyll b .. 16.CO µg/l
Chlorophyll c .. 35.80 µg/l
Carotenoids .. 5.34 MSP/M3
The yellow:green pigment ratio was generally between 2.50 to 3.50 and the range of variation was from 1.60 to 4.40 ( with an occasional 7.50). The plankton settlement volume varied between 25 to 130 c3. The peak values in pigments usually occurred during morning and late evening hours.
